How tall is the Statue of Liberty in feet?

The Statue of Liberty is one of the most famous landmarks in the United States. It is located on Liberty Island in New York Harbor and is a symbol of freedom and democracy. The statue is 151 feet tall and stands on a pedestal that is 154 feet tall, making the height of the entire sculpture 305 feet. The green color of the statue comes from copper sheets that are supported by an internal iron framework.

Which is the world biggest Statue?

The Statue of Unity is the world’s tallest statue, with a height of 182 metres (597 feet). It is located near Kevadia in the state of Gujarat, India. The statue is a monument to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el, a leader of the Indian independence movement and the first Deputy Prime Minister of India.
